FFG Fashion Foie Gras
Fashion Foie Gras is a fashion blog based in London and aimed predominantly at a UK audience. Although some content is relevant to audiences elsewhere especially during New York Fashion Week, which is heavily covered by the blog. Fashion Foie Gras was founded in September 2009 and is run entirely by Emily Johnston. She says, "Fashion Foie Gras was founded with the idea of creating one place where all things newsworthy for fashion and style are reported 24 hours a day, 7 days a week! Since the first post went live we've certainly seen more than we ever thought possible for FFG. Every day brings a new opportunity for a collaboration or event and each moment we discover something new about the fashionable world we live in." The Editor of the blog Emily Johnston contributes to a number of publications including Cosmopolitan, The Huffington Post, Glamour and Stylist. The blog has been mentioned by the following publications: Glamour, Stylist, ELLE, The Daily Mail You Magazine, London Metro, Vogue, Red and The Huffington Post. In July 2012 the blog was nominated in the Cosmopolitan 2012 Blog Awards for Best Established Blogger sponsored by Next. The main feature on Fashion Foie Gras is called 'Outfit de Jour' which is simply just Outfit of the Day and is regularly updated. Along with fashion news, articles and features the blog also publishes some Hotel, Restaurant and Travel Reviews too. Fashion Foie Gras is updated very regularly with blog posts appearing four or five times a day. PR opportunities mainly exist in the form of product reviews, competition giveaways, hotel reviews and fashion news. FFGCU 360 Magazine
Written for alumni, donors, faculty, staff, community and other supporters of Florida Gulf Coast University. Focuses on university accomplishments with main features as well as departments that include: How To, Collective We (campus clubs), Spotlight (profile of faculty or staff member), Student Success, The Arts, Sports, Alumni, By the Numbers, Objects of Affection, Food Forage (focus on the campus Food Forest), President’s Message, Cutting Edge (research), Community (impact on region), Giving.
